Both defects came out of Phase 13's acceptance walk, and neither was visible to any test. **1. The one-shot rule-group guard was not a guard.** `seedRuleGroup` and `coreRules.seedGroup` both read their settings stamp, inserted the whole group, and wrote the stamp AFTER the loop. Two instances booting in the same moment both read "absent" and both insert -- the walk ended up with 52 module rules where the module ships 26. `docker compose up --scale app=2` and a rolling restart both start two instances on purpose, so this is ordinary rather than exotic. `settings.db` gains `claim(key, value)`: the same `INSERT IGNORE` as `seedDefault`, reporting its own `affectedRows`, so exactly one caller can win a key. The atomicity is the PRIMARY KEY's -- no transaction, no lock, the same bargain `engagementWorker`'s row claim already makes. Both seeders claim before inserting. The trade the code already documented is unchanged, only its order: a process that dies mid-loop leaves the group stamped and partly seeded, and the missing rules are an operator's visit to the "new rule" form. A duplicate rule is two mails per event, for every rule in the group, which both functions' own comments already call the worse outcome. **Why no test caught it:** the stubs supplied `get` and `set` over a Map, which cannot race, so they agreed with the bug -- Phase 4a's `foundRows` finding in a different costume. The fake is now `claim`-shaped and decides without yielding, exactly as the table does, and both suites gained a test that runs two seeders with `Promise.all` and asserts one insert each. Verified by reverting the fix: the module test then reports every rule inserted twice. **2. A rule that names a `digest` body could not be saved.** `registries.js` `checkSeedRule` permits `digest` in as many words -- it is the body `teamDigestWorker` renders for a rule whose email channel an individual set to digest mode, so it never appears in `channels` and never could -- and MODULE_API.md 2.4 tells modules they may point `template_keys` at `notify.digest`. `engagementRules.model.js` then rejected any key that was not one of the rule's channels. So every rule shipping a digest body answered an operator who opened it and pressed Save with a 400 naming a key they had never typed: core's own Team and news rules, and sixteen of module-uo's. The only way to save was to delete the digest body, silently dropping digest support from that rule. The two validators now agree; anything that is neither a channel nor `digest` is still refused, with a test for each direction. No MODULE_API bump: no member is added, removed or changed, and the documented contract is what the code now honours rather than something new. Co-Authored-By: Claude <noreply@anthropic.com>
